Mahra, Socotra announce support to legality, reject SB's inciting calls
[08/08/2019 08:41]

MAHRA-SABA
Mahra Local Authority has announced support to legality under President Abd-Rabbo Mansour Hadi.

In a release issued by local authority on Thursday, the authority announced rejection to violence, harming public stability and targeting civilians and public institutions in the transitional capital of Aden by the militia of Security Belt (SB) led by the so-called Hani bin Buraik.

he local authority pointed out that such practices serve only Houthi rebel militia, terrorist elements and their supporters.

The local authority renewed support of people of Mahra to the government and all measures it takes for protecting security and stability.

It also praised efforts of Saudi Arabia and its support to constitutional legality represented by President Abd-Rabbo Mansour Hadi.

Province of Socotra made similar release supporting the legality and government for protecting government's institutions in Aden and public security and stability.
